Dr Navid Toosisaidy

n.toosisaidy@uq.edu.au

Publications

Journal Articles (3)

Journal Articles

Shafiee, Abbas, Cavalcanti, Amanda S., Saidy, Navid T., Schneidereit, Dominik, Friedrich, Oliver, Ravichandran, Akhilandeshwari, De-Juan-Pardo, Elena M. and Hutmacher, Dietmar W. (2021). Convergence of 3D printed biomimetic wound dressings and adult stem cell therapy. Biomaterials, 268 120558, 1-16. doi: 10.1016/j.biomaterials.2020.120558
Somszor, Katarzyna, Bas, Onur, Karimi, Fatemeh, Shabab, Tara, Saidy, Navid T., O'Connor, Andrea J., Ellis, Amanda V., Hutmacher, Dietmar and Heath, Daniel E. (2020). Personalized, mechanically strong, and biodegradable coronary artery stents via melt electrowriting. ACS Macro Letters, 9 (12), 1732-1739. doi: 10.1021/acsmacrolett.0c00644
Saidy, Navid T., Shabab, Tara, Bas, Onur, Rojas-González, Diana M., Menne, Matthias, Henry, Tim, Hutmacher, Dietmar W., Mela, Petra and De-Juan-Pardo, Elena M. (2020). Melt electrowriting of complex 3D anatomically relevant scaffolds. Frontiers in Bioengineering and Biotechnology, 8 793, 1-14. doi: 10.3389/fbioe.2020.00793
